**Action item (P2, owner: release manager):** Dark-mode regression in the Ostrel admin dashboard shipped because theme tokens aren't covered by visual diff tests. Several panels rendered black-on-black for two days before a support ticket surfaced it. Fix: add the token audit step to the release checklist and block deploys when the contrast linter fails. Target: next minor release. Do not ship partial theme updates again; all-or-nothing per component. Rollout criteria and the linter setup guide are documented on the internal page below.

dashboard of bafof-hafog = https://confluence.lumiclabs.internal/display/browse/display/6a09a20a

Subject: Evac-chair store — night shift. The evacuation-chair store behind stairwell D at Lowbarrow House was restocked today; three chairs, all serviced. Check the seals on your first round and log it in the night book. Report any broken seal to the duty manager before 02:00. The store door opens with the code below.

staff pass of kawep-hahap = bdg-IEUUF-6

Quarterly Planning Note – Brindlewood Outfitters

Hi all — here's the short version of the Q3 cash-flow forecast for branch managers. Inflows look steady thanks to the Trailmark boot line, but we're expecting a pinch in August when the new Pellam Road depot invoices land. Keep discretionary spend light through mid-September and flag any big purchase orders to Renata before committing. If collections hold up, we should end the quarter comfortably in the black. One more thing, and keep this one close — see the confidential note below.

internal memo for faweg-tafog: Only 7 of the 100 pilot accounts renewed Quenael, so a churn review is set for April 15.